Job Description

We are seeking a Lead AWS Cloud Cost Optimization Engineer to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ate should be an expert in core cloud services architecture and cost mechanics.
You should have hands-on experience in DevOps or SRE, possess deep experience in cost analysis and optimization in large AWS environments, have a passion for data analysis, and be a team player who can collaborate with others across the organization.
As a Lead AWS Cloud Engineer, you will have the opportunity to lead and mentor a team of skilled professionals, providing critical guidance and technical leadership in delivering high-quality AWS solutions.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the design and implementation of scalable, secure, and cost-effective AWS solutions
  • Provide technical leadership and expertise in architecting AWS cloud infrastructure
  • Collaborate with engineering teams to ensure the effectiveness of cost improvements
  • Lead and mentor a team of cloud engineers, providing technical guidance and support
  • Analyze the client's product architecture and deployment costs
  • Advise on architecture, waste management, and resource optimization in partnership with architects and engineers
  • Investigate and monitor increases in cloud expenses to identify the sources
  • Manage cloud reservation/savings plans and repurpose available capacity
  • Examine data patterns and anomalies to derive actionable insights
  • Propose savings opportunities relating to cloud commitments such as Reserved Instances and Savings Plans
  • Develop strategies and plans for efficiency improvements
  • Create and maintain reports, dashboards, and alerts for cloud costs and utilization
  • Implement automated reporting for cost tracking and compliance
  • Establish, automate, and govern Cost Optimization policies and practices
  • Report on KPIs and suggest potential savings options
